Rincon Tank
Rincon Tank is a reservoir in Apache, Arizona and has an elevation of 8,514 feet.Places in the Area

Alpine is a census-designated place in Apache County, Arizona, United States, in Bush Valley in the east central part of the state. As of the 2010 census, it had a population of 145. It is located near the eastern border of the state.
